先說偽元素和偽類的區別: 偽類是針對CSS,而偽元素是針對HTML,偽類選擇器是CSS選擇器的一種,而偽類是“假”的HTML標簽 偽類(選擇器)本質上是為了彌補常規CSS選擇器的不足,以便獲取到更多信息; 偽元素本質上是創建了一個有內容的虛擬容器; 在CSS3中,偽類和偽元素的語法得到 ...
先說偽元素和偽類的區別: 偽類是針對CSS,而偽元素是針對HTML,偽類選擇器是CSS選擇器的一種,而偽類是“假”的HTML標簽 偽類(選擇器)本質上是為了彌補常規CSS選擇器的不足,以便獲取到更多信息; 偽元素本質上是創建了一個有內容的虛擬容器; 在CSS3中,偽類和偽元素的語法得到 ...
css選擇器常見包括id(#id)、標簽(tag)、class(.class)、屬性[attr=attrval]等,還包括偽元素和偽類選擇器。正確的利用偽元素和偽類能夠讓我們的html結構更清晰合理,也能在一定程度上減少js對dom的操作! 定義 偽類包含兩種:狀態偽類和結構性偽類。 狀態偽 ...
1,::first-line 對塊元素的第一行文本進行格式化 2 ::first-letter 文本的首字母設置特殊樣式 (只能是塊級元素) 3,::before 在元素的前面插入新內容,配合content使用 注意:1,第一個子元素 2,是行內元素 ...
CSS偽元素是用來添加一些選擇器的特殊效果。用於:向某個選擇器中的文字的首行。 ㈠語法 ①偽元素的語法: ②CSS類也可以使用偽元素: ㈡:first-line 偽元素 ⑴"first-line" 偽元素用於向文本的首行設置特殊樣式 ...
css的偽元素,之所以被稱為偽元素,是因為他們不是真正的頁面元素,html沒有對應的元素,但是其所有用法和表現行為與真正的頁面元素一樣,可以對其使用諸如頁面元素一樣的css樣式,表面上看上去貌似是頁面的某些元素來展現,實際上是css樣式展現的行為,因此被稱為偽元素。如下圖,是偽元素在html代碼 ...
前端er們大都或多或少地接觸過CSS偽類和偽元素,比如最常見的:focus、:hover以及<a>標簽的:link、:visited等,偽元素較常見的比如:before、:after等。 在這里也許有不少人都見過:before,::before這樣的寫法,估計有些人很納悶,這兩者 ...
轉載:http://www.cnblogs.com/ihardcoder/p/5294927.html CSS3偽類和偽元素的特性和區別 前端er們大都或多或少地接觸過CSS偽類和偽元素,比如最常見的:focus,:hover以及<a>標簽的:link ...
在項目列表中經常會用到圓點,圓點可以用圖片展示,但圖片必然占據項目容量,在小程序中項目大小尤為重要,較大的時候還要用到分包處理。 怎么用偽類寫圓點呢?人狠話不都直接上圖、上代碼 ...